Cr - V (Chromium – Vanadium)

A. Watson, S. Wagner, E. Lysova, L. Rokhlin

Literature Data

A number of thermodynamic assessments for the Cr-V system appeared in literature [1982Smi, 1989Kau, 1991Oka, 1992Lee]. The phase diagram in [Mas2], based on [1982Smi], showing a distinct minimum in both the solidus and liquidus, is however, in disagreement with experimental work of [1969Rud] and [1985Koc].
